Merge pull request #13357 from JimMoen/fix-utf8-frame-error-connack

Stop returning `CONNACK` or `DISCONNECT` to clients that sent malformed CONNECT packets.

- Only send `CONNACK` with reason code `frame_too_large` for MQTT-v5.0 when connecting if the protocol version field in CONNECT can be detected.
- Otherwise **DONOT** send any CONNACK or DISCONNECT packet.
